Two Juveniles Accused Of Robbing School District Employee’s Vehicle In Indio

Two juveniles accused of an armed carjacking at an elementary school parking lot were arrested when they were seen driving that vehicle nearby.

The robbery was reported at Herbert Hoover Elementary School around 6:00 a.m. on Tuesday. Police officers said they learned that an employee with DSUSD was approached in a school site parking lot by two people as the victim exited the vehicle.


It is believed the two individuals were armed with a handgun and took the victim out of the car against their will, police said. An officer later saw the stolen vehicle and attempted a traffic stop at Hoover Avenue and Sun Gold Street, just around the corner from the school where the robbery initially took place.


Police that the driver did not yield to the officer's attempts for a traffic stop and a pursuit ensued. The pursuit went into the city of Coachella and ended when the driver oversteered while making a turn.

The vehicle ended up in a vacant dirt field near Cesar Chavez Street between Avenue 53 and Avenue 54.


Police said they did not locate any weapons at the scene. The vehicle was recovered and returned to the owner.
